The SIP Pro B16 16-speed bench pillar drill is a robust and versatile tool, ideal for a wide range of workshop tasks. Its powerful 550W motor effortlessly handles ferrous and non-ferrous metals, wood, and plastics, making it perfect for pilot holes, blind holes, batch drilling, and general applications. Precision is key; the adjustable tilting table with integrated tilt scale allows for accurate positioning and controlled drilling. Built for longevity and safety, this drill features integrated chuck guards and a heavy-duty cast iron base for exceptional stability. Its compact bench-mounted design is perfect for workshops with limited space, whilst remaining ideal for manufacturing gates, rails, trailers, and other metalwork or woodwork projects. The 16-speed functionality offers precise control over hole size, ensuring consistent, high-quality results. Ease of use is further enhanced by the adjustable drilling table and three-lever handle. A drilling depth stop ensures accurate repetitive or blind hole drilling, minimising material waste. A safety interlock switch prevents accidental start-up during motor belt adjustments.
